Goin Duffy! 3rd Ward rapper Paco Troxclair’s “Duffy” is all New Orleans. If you’re from the city, the entire vibe of the song and video makes you feel at home.
Set in front of some old projects and second lines, the video is equipped with bikes, camouflage, Mardi Gras Indians, rims, uptown, and a good time. This is New Orleans. The sound is brought to you by long time New Orleans producer KLC the Drummer.
